Default Rim/Wheel compatibility between 92-96 to 97-01

Does anyone know if the stock wheels/rims from the 5th generation (97-01) will fit on the 4th generation (92-96)? I want to get back to stock wheels. Please let me know.

All Preludes previous to 1997 are 4 lug, and 1997+ are 5 lug.
